Health Unit and Schools Preparing for Fall Flu Season
It will be a ‘different’ flu season this year as the Grey Bruce Health Unit and the Ministry of Health and Long-Term Care prepare for the 2009/10 flu season.
Directors of the Bluewater District and the Bruce Grey Catholic District Schools met with Medical Officer of Health Dr. Hazel Lynn and key Health Unit staff, August 11, to strategize how things will be managed this fall within Grey and Bruce County schools.
One of the major areas of focus will be an accurate surveillance of illness and the resulting absenteeism in the schools. Parents will be asked if their child’s absence from school is due to flu-like symptoms (fever, cough, sore throat) or gastro-intestinal (vomiting, diarrhea) or other. This information is very useful in the early detection of outbreaks before they reach their potential peak level. Outbreaks in the school often precede larger community-based outbreaks.
“We appreciate the partnerships between the school boards and the Health Unit to work together to protect the health of our community.” says Medical Officer of Health Dr. Hazel Lynn.
The Health Unit will be working with the school boards to provide timely and accurate information to families through school newsletters, take-home flyers, etc.
As well, the Health Unit has set up a H1N1 section on their website at: www.publichealthgreybruce.on.ca New information and resources will be posted as they become available.
